Partner
THOMAS, KENNEDY, SAMPSON, EDWARDS & PATTERSON
1600 Bank South Building
55 Marietta Street, N.W.
Atlanta, Georgia 30303
(404) 688-4503
Term: September, 1974-July, 1992
Position Summary: Primary responsibilities include civil litigation with an emphasis on personal injury litigation (plaintiff and defendant). Significant experience in civil rights' litigation in matters involving housing, voting rights and school desegregation. Litigation efforts accomplished the historic election of black-elected officials in Marietta and College Park, Georgia, and faculty and pupil desegregation in DeKalb County (Georgia) schools.
